Why temperature is not below absolute temperature? Aren't there any place in the universe lower than this?

OpenStudy (anonymous):

Absolute 0 degrees kelvin is the point where there is no transfer of energy between atoms, atoms stop moving, as such, nothing can be colder than absolute 0K.
